Sadarpur

Sadarpur is a village located in Jaisinghpur tehsil of Sultanpur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 13km away from sub-district headquarter Jaisinghpur (tehsildar office) and 31km away from district headquarter Sultanpur. As per 2009 stats, Sadarpur village is also a gram panchayat.

About Sadarp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sadarpur is 170129. The village spans a total geographical area of 91 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 228142. Sultanpur is nearest town to Sadarp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 33km away.

Population of Sadarpur

Below is a concise population overview of Sadarpur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 918 462 456
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 137 75 62
Scheduled Castes (SC) 105 60 45
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 1 1 N/A
Literate Population 581 329 252
Illiterate Population 337 133 204

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Sadarpur village:

  • The total population of Sadarpur village is around 918, including approximately 462 males and 456 females, with a sex ratio of 987 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 137 children aged 0–6 years in Sadarpur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Sadarpur village has 105 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 1 person from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Sadarpur village is about 63.29%, with male literacy at 71.21% and female literacy at 55.26%.
  • There are around 158 households in Sadarpur village.

Connectivity of Sadarp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sadarpur. As per the 2011 stats, Sadarp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
